First Sony Alpha Phone: What to Expect

Sony, renowned for its high-quality Alpha cameras, is rumored to be venturing into the smartphone market with a device potentially incorporating its acclaimed imaging technology. The prospect of a Sony Alpha phone has sent ripples of excitement through photography enthusiasts and tech aficionados alike. While official confirmation remains elusive, let's delve into the potential features and expectations surrounding this highly anticipated device.

The Whispers of a Revolutionary Camera Phone:

The rumors swirling around a Sony Alpha phone aren't just idle speculation. Sony's expertise in image sensors and lens technology is unparalleled. For years, many smartphone manufacturers have incorporated Sony sensors into their devices, consistently achieving impressive photographic results. A phone bearing the Alpha name promises to take this collaboration a step further.

Expected Features and Specifications:

While details remain scarce, several anticipated features are circulating within the tech community:

  • Unparalleled Image Quality: The most significant expectation is, without a doubt, exceptional image quality. Expect features like a high-resolution main sensor, potentially exceeding 50MP, alongside advanced image processing capabilities. We might see features like advanced RAW processing directly on the phone, enabling unparalleled control over image editing.
  • Versatile Lens System: Sony's Alpha camera system is celebrated for its extensive lens selection. While a phone obviously can't accommodate interchangeable lenses, we anticipate a versatile multi-lens setup. This might include a telephoto lens for stunning zoom capabilities, an ultrawide lens for expansive landscapes, and perhaps even a dedicated macro lens for close-up photography.
  • Professional-Grade Video Recording: Beyond stills, expect top-tier video capabilities. Features like 4K or even 8K video recording, high frame rates, and advanced stabilization technologies are likely contenders. The integration of Sony's renowned video processing algorithms could result in incredibly cinematic footage.
  • Robust Design and Build Quality: Given Sony's reputation, we expect a premium build quality. This likely means a durable chassis, perhaps made of high-quality materials like aluminum or reinforced glass, alongside a sleek, sophisticated design.
  • Powerful Processor and Ample RAM: To handle the demanding image processing and high-resolution displays, a powerful processor and ample RAM are essential. We anticipate a flagship-level processor and a minimum of 8GB of RAM.

Addressing Potential Concerns:

While the anticipation is high, some concerns remain:

  • Price Point: A phone incorporating Sony's top-tier camera technology is likely to come with a premium price tag. This could potentially limit its accessibility to a niche market of serious photography enthusiasts and professionals.
  • Software Integration: Sony's camera software is known for its extensive manual controls. Successfully integrating this into a user-friendly smartphone interface will be crucial for mass-market appeal.
  • Battery Life: Powerful processors and high-resolution displays often demand significant battery power. Sony will need to carefully manage power consumption to deliver a satisfactory battery life.
